In its first 28 days, Netflix reported that the series was viewed by 62 million households, making it then the most-watched limited series on Netflix ever.
The show has made some impacts on the chess world, both negative and positive.
The Queen’s Gambit first debuted on Netflix in October 2020 and is set during the Cold War era where Anya Taylor-Joy’s Beth struggles with addiction in a quest to become the greatest chess player in the world.
The Walter Tevis novel of the same name that the series is based on also became a New York Times bestseller decades after its original release in 1983.
